4 churrerías for breakfast on January 1 in Santa Cruz de Tenerife

Do you already know what to do when the clock strikes the early hours of January 1? Whether you spent the night partying to celebrate the new year or decided to get up early to start 2024 on the right foot, there is something that usually does not fail at breakfast on the first day of the year: churros with chocolate.

These are four churrerías in Santa Cruz de Tenerife to continue with the tradition:

1. The Traditional Churrería

Its specialty is churros and chocolate to take away or eat at the cafeteria located on Valentín Sanz Street, 3. Open from 6:00 a.m., it offers quality products and good service.

2. Churrería La Competencia

Also open from 6:00 a.m., the churros with chocolate fly on José Hernández Alfonso street, 4.

3. Churrería Presidente

On José Manuel Guimerá Street, 32, right in the heart of the Santa Cruz market (La Recova), it is one of the favorite places for chicharreros and chicharreras for a good hot chocolate accompanied by churros. Quality and tradition from 6:00 a.m.

4. Churrería La Monja

The usual churrería on Paralela dos A Nardo Street, 8. “Authentic artisan churros and now also with Mexican food and a wide range of sandwiches, sandwiches, hamburgers, potatoes, breakfasts.”
